Chief Well being Officer Dr Brett Sutton warned that hazardous smoke haze might result in critical aggravation of well being results in individuals over 65, youngsters 14 years and youthful, pregnant girls and people with current coronary heart or lung circumstances.
He additionally stated many individuals may need signs equivalent to coughing or shortness of breath.
Dr Sutton suggested these with bronchial asthma to have their administration plans and drugs available as signs and publicity required.
For these severely impacted by the smoke, Dr Sutton stated face masks had been an choice.

“Abnormal paper mud masks, handkerchiefs or bandannas don’t filter out high-quality particles from bushfire smoke and are usually not very helpful in defending your lungs.
“P2 or N95 masks filter bushfire smoke, offering higher safety in opposition to inhaling high-quality particles.
